Hi there! My name is Dunkin and I`m one happy-go-lucky pup looking for my forever home. I`m an affectionate guy who loves nothing more than getting all the snuggles and pets from the people I meet. When I`m not cuddling, I enjoy a good game of fetch and will happily sit and take treats from my new friends. If you`re looking for a goofy, loving pup to add to your family, then I`m your guy! Come meet me and see how much joy I can bring into your life. I am fully grown at ~48lbs. How did I get here? Transferred from Craven Pamlico Animal Services.

The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als (SPCA) of Wake County is dedicated to creating a more humane community where every adoptable animal has a home. Each year the SPCA rehomes over 3,500 animals through its innovative adoption programs.
The mission of the SPCA is to transform the lives of pets and people through protection, care, education, and adoption.
The SPCA of Wake County is a local, independent, non-profit organization that receives no government funding or tax dollars. We rely almost entirely on private donations to fund our annual operating budget of $3 million. The SPCA of Wake County is not affiliated with, nor do we receive funding from the ASPCA (American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als).
